Understanding Of Hair Transplantation?

Hair transplantation is a medical procedure where healthy hair follicles are taken from one part of the scalp, usually the back or sides of the head and transplanted into areas experiencing hair loss or baldness.

 

The donor area is chosen because the hair follicles there are genetically resistant to hair loss. These follicles continue to grow even after being moved to another area of the scalp.

 

This concept is known as “donor dominance.” It means the transplanted hair keeps the characteristics of the donor area, making it resistant to future hair fall in most cases.

 

Why Are Hair Transplants Considered Permanent?

 

The transplanted follicles are usually taken from areas that are not affected by male or female pattern baldness. Once these follicles are implanted into the balding area, they continue to produce hair naturally for many years.

 

Unlike temporary hair loss solutions like Hair fibers, wigs, hair patches, and medications, hair transplantation provides a long-lasting and natural solution.

 

After successful healing, the transplanted hair behaves like your natural hair. You can:

 

  • Wash it
  • Cut it
  • Style it
  • Oil it
  • Comb it normally

Top Factors That Affect Hair Transplant Longevity

 

Although hair transplants are considered permanent, several factors influence how successful and long-lasting the results will be.

 

1. Surgeon’s Expertise

 

A skilled and experienced hair expert or surgeon plays a major role in achieving natural and permanent results. Proper graft handling, hairline design, and implantation techniques directly affect hair survival rates.

 

2. Donor Hair Quality

 

Donors with dense, strong hair typically have a greater likelihood of achieving long term coverage when using donor hair for transplant surgery. If donors have healthy donor areas, they will have the best chance of achieving a successful long term coverage.

 

3. Hair Loss Pattern

 

Hair Loss Pattern

Hair transplant surgery replaces missing hair in balding areas; however, hair transplant surgeries will not prevent further natural hair loss in untouched/remaining hair. Therefore, a younger person who is experiencing accelerated hair loss, may experience a need for additional hair restoration procedures at some point later in his/her life.

 

4. Post-Procedure Care

 

Following hair transplantation aftercare instructions is essential for proper healing and graft survival. Patients are usually advised to:

 

  • Avoid scratching the scalp
  • Stay away from smoking and alcohol temporarily
  • Avoid heavy workouts initially
  • Use prescribed medications and shampoos

5. Overall Health & Lifestyle

 

The overall health of hair is influenced by factors such as: nutrition deficiencies, smoking or other lifestyle habits; as well as any underlying medical issues (eg: hormone imbalances) that may impair normal hair growth or cause premature loss of hair, which will subsequently affect the long-term results from a hair transplant.

 

Can You Lose Non-Transplanted Hair?

 

Yes. While transplanted hair is generally permanent, the surrounding natural hair may continue to thin over time if hair loss progresses.

 

For example:

 

  • A person may get a transplant in the front hairline
  • Years later, untreated hair behind the transplanted area may thin naturally

Is Hair Transplant Permanent for Everyone?

 

In most cases, yes. However, individual results can vary depending on:

 

  • Genetics
  • Type of hair loss
  • Medical conditions
  • Lifestyle habits
  • Procedure quality

Patients with stable hair loss patterns usually experience the best long-term outcomes.

 

People expecting extremely thick hair in completely bald areas may need realistic expectations. A hair transplant improves appearance significantly, but results depend on available donor hair and scalp condition.
